You are here >> Empowerment Center >> Exercise Tips Yoga Exercises For A Mind and Body WorkoutBecause of the recent craze, few people realize that yoga exercises have been around for more than 5,000 years. It was first introduced to the United States in the 1960s. In recent years, it seems that yoga exercises have exploded in fitness centers all over country. Are yoga exercises here to stay or are they just another passing fad? The exercises are certainly popular for now as more people look for an exercise program that works their mind and spirit as well as their body. Yoga exercises were first developed in India years ago as a way to exercise the mind and body. The exercises are made up of poses, postures and positions that help to align the muscles and bones. This alignment is believed to promote a sense of unity and balance. When the body has a feeling of body, the mind in turn, also has a feeling of balance. Many people begin to see improvements with after only a few rounds of yoga exercises. Improvements in flexibility, strength, and stress levels are seen fairly quickly. There is no equipment necessary for yoga exercises, so they can be done wherever the space is available. Classes may be free if you belong to a health club from $5 to $20 at private studios. There are many branches of yoga exercises. After you select a style of yoga that you would like to do, it is important that you stick to it since it can take time to get used to the terminology that is used and the moves that are involved. The terminology might be difficult to learn in conjunction with getting into shape. Classes can be easy to challenging so make sure that you select a class that matches your fitness level. The spirituality aspect of classes is also important when you are making a selection.
